Ingredients, Substitutions & Foolproof Steps
Ingredients List:
- 1 cup unsalted butter — Softened to room temperature for easier creaming; coconut oil and vegan butter work for a dairy-free alternative.
- 1 cup brown sugar, packed — Adds moisture and a rich flavor; can substitute with maple syrup for a light caramel note.
- 1 cup granulated sugar — Provides sweetness and a slight crispness to the cookies; feel free to use coconut sugar for a healthier twist.
- 2 large eggs — Binds all ingredients together; for a vegan option, use flax eggs.
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ract — Enhances sweetness; almond extract is a great substitute for a unique flavor.
- 1 cup all-purpose flour — Gives structure to the cookies; whole wheat flour can increase fiber content.
- 1 teaspoon baking soda — Helps cookies rise; cream of tartar can be used for a more complex flavor.
- 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on — Adds warmth and depth; nutmeg can be an exciting alternative.
- 1/2 teaspoon salt — Balances sweetness; omit if you prefer a less salty cookie.
- 3 cups rolled oats — Provides texture; quick oats can be substituted for softer cookies.
- 1 cup marshmallow fluff — Creates a thick, fluffy filling; whipped cream or vegan cream can serve as a delightful alternative.
- 1/2 cup powdered sugar — Sweetens the filling and helps it hold together; honey can be a non-powder alternative.
Directions/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).
- In a large bowl, cream together the softened butter, brown sugar, and granulated sugar until smooth.
- Beat in the eggs one at a time, then stir in the vanilla.
- Combine the flour, baking soda, cinnamon, and salt; gradually stir into the creamed mixture.
- Mix in the oats until well combined.
- Drop rounded tablespoons of batter onto ungreased baking sheets.
- Bake 10-12 minutes in the preheated oven or until the edges are golden brown.
- Allow cookies to cool on sheets for 5 minutes before transferring to a wire rack to cool completely.
- For the filling, beat together marshmallow fluff and powdered sugar until smooth.
- Spread filling on the flat side of one cookie and top with another to make a sandwich. Enjoy!
Common Mistakes to Avoid:
- Overmixing the dough can lead to dense cookies; mix just until combined.
- Not letting the cookies cool completely before filling can result in a gooey mess.
- Skipping the resting time can affect the texture, so let the dough chill for an hour if time allows.
Pro Tips:
- Use an ice cream scoop for uniform cookie sizes.
- For added flavor, consider mixing in chocolate chips or nuts into the dough.
- If your filling lacks structure, add more powdered sugar until desired consistency.

Serving, Storage & Freezer Tips
How to Serve Homemade Oatmeal Cream Pies Nothing says comfort like a fresh oatmeal cream pie. Serve these delightful treats at room temperature, paired with a glass of milk or a cup of coffee for a delicious midday break. They also make a fantastic addition to dessert platters at gatherings.
How to Store Homemade Oatmeal Cream Pies Store your c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to five days. For maximum freshness, place a slice of bread inside the container; it helps keep the cookies soft and chewy.
Can You Freeze Homemade Oatmeal Cream Pies? Absolutely! To freeze, wrap each cookie individually in plastic wrap and place them in a freezer-safe bag. They will remain fresh for up to three months. Thaw them at room temperature before enjoying, and they’ll taste as good as new!

FAQ Section
1. Can I make these cookies healthier? Absolutely! You can use whole grain flour, reduce the sugar, or incorporate nuts to enhance the nutritional value while still enjoying the delicious taste of oatmeal cream pies.
2. What can I substitute for marshmallow fluff? You can use whipped cream for a lighter filling or a plant-based cream for a dairy-free alternative. Both options provide a delightful creaminess.
3. How can I prevent my cookies from spreading too much? Chill your cookie dough before baking. This helps the cookies hold their shape while they bake, preventing them from becoming too flat.
4. Can I double the recipe? Yes, feel free to double the quantities! Just make sure you have enough space on your baking sheets and adjust the baking time if necessary.
